One could argue that the introduction of the Borg represents a repudiation of the Federation's ethos of diplomacy as the ultimate form of problem solving.
Except in "Q Who," Picard does save his ship by negotiating. He talks his way out of it. Not with the Borg, but with the bigger power: Q.
November 25, 2025 at 3:59 AM
In "Q Who," the Enterprise encounters 2 different types of god: Q, a classic omnipotent deity, and the Borg, who've turned themselves into their own collective machine god.

They're basically opposites, warm chaos vs cold ruthlessness.

I just love it when STAR TREK dips its toe into cosmic horror.
